Transaction 19791383643ebc8e02ce0eeeec306f0d05293cf81ce51081979f5f99c001cb41

1 Input
2 Outputs
  • 19791383643ebc8e02ce0eeeec306f0d05293cf81ce51081979f5f99c001cb41:0
  • value  27623012
    address  3JtoMVv3QmZLfhNTT7uiw6SnMYTtpYQDK7
  • 19791383643ebc8e02ce0eeeec306f0d05293cf81ce51081979f5f99c001cb41:1
  • value  8104557
    address  19HwWQ472S7ur6Xtx7qyBnb6RZDUaoaF2z